WebIf you have purchased fresh yeast, however, you will need to refrigerate it to keep it fresh. The cold will slow down the processes of the fungi in the yeast to keep it from going bad. Keep fresh yeast in your fridge gives it the longest shelf life possible. You can expect your fresh yeast to last in your fridge for 2 or 3 weeks.
